What Is an M6 Socket Head?

At its core, the m6 socket head screw is a cylindrical fastener with a hexagonal (Allen) recessed drive. This recess allows installation or removal with an Allen key or hex wrench, offering better torque control and compact design compared to standard hex bolts. The “M6” part means it has a 6mm nominal diameter of its threaded shaft—large enough for moderate load-bearing without being bulky.

In practice, these bolts are prized for their neat fit in tight spaces, ease of automated assembly, and high mechanical strength, making them perfect for everything from precision instruments to heavy turbines.

Core Components & Key Factors in M6 Socket Heads

Durability

Most M6 socket heads are crafted from high-grade steel—often alloyed or stainless—to resist corrosion and wear. This makes them endure harsh environments, whether it’s marine, automotive, or outdoor construction.

Precision Manufacturing

They’re produced to rigorous ISO standards (mainly ISO 4762 for socket screws), ensuring thread pitch, head dimensions, and drive profiles are consistent. This standardization means interchangeable parts worldwide—no nasty surprises mid-project.

Cost Efficiency

Oddly enough, while these bolts offer advanced functionality, they remain quite affordable due to mass manufacturing. Buying in bulk often reduces costs substantially, which is a big deal for large-scale projects.

Scalability & Versatility

Because of their modular thread size, M6 socket heads fit into many designs—from consumer electronics to large machinery. Scalable production and straightforward installation make them versatile staples.

Safety & Reliability

The precision fit, combined with high tensile strength (many qualify for property class 12.9), ensures components stay securely fastened—even under vibration or thermal cycling.

Typical M6 Socket Head Specifications
Specification Details
Thread Diameter 6 mm
Pitch 1.0 mm (standard fine thread available)
Head Height Approx. 4 mm
Material Carbon Steel, Stainless Steel, Alloy Steel
Drive Type Hex Socket (Allen Key)
Tensile Strength Up to 1200 MPa (Property class 12.9)

Common Challenges & Solutions

Obviously, it’s not all perfect. Cross-threading or over-torquing remains a concern, especially where untrained labor or rushed assembly occur. Some manufacturers address this by offering pre-lubricated or torque-limiting socket screws to minimize mistakes.

Supply chain interruptions have also made companies cautious; sourcing quality M6 socket heads from trusted vendors with ISO certifications is a must. Additionally, some environments require specialized coatings to avoid galvanic corrosion when mixed metals are used.

FAQ: Your Questions About M6 Socket Heads

Q: What’s the main advantage of an M6 socket head over a regular hex bolt?
A: The recessed hex drive lets you apply more torque in tight spaces with less risk of slipping. It’s also more compact and suited for machine assembly lines, making it a favorite for precision work.
Q: How long can an M6 socket head bolt last in outdoor or marine environments?
When made from stainless steel or coated properly, these bolts can last many years without significant corrosion. Of course, extreme conditions demand periodic inspections.
Q: Are M6 socket head bolts compatible with automated assembly?
Absolutely. Their standardized hex drive and dimensions make them ideal for robotic installation, improving speed and consistency on production lines.
Q: Can I use an M6 socket head bolt in electrical equipment?
Yes, especially in assemblies requiring high precision and tight fastening. Just ensure the bolt material is suited for the electrical environment, sometimes requiring insulated coatings.
